WebApr 10, 2024 · 1 Answer. math.pi is a constant in Python that represents the mathematical constant pi, which is the ratio of the circumference of a circle to its diameter. It is a built-in constant in the math module and has a value of approximately 3.141592653589793. In this example, we import the math module and use math.pi to calculate the area of a circle ... WebPossible issues. pi always rounds to the nearest floating-point number when used. This means that exact mathematical identities involving \(\pi\) will generally not be preserved in floating-point arithmetic. Web2 days ago · The result is between -pi and pi. The vector in the plane from the origin to point (x, y) makes this angle with the positive X axis. The point of atan2() is that the signs of both inputs are known to it, so it can compute the correct quadrant for the angle. For example, atan(1) and atan2(1, 1) are both pi/4, but atan2(-1,-1) is -3*pi/4. math ...
